Experiment in using GitHub CLI to authenticate fetching docker images from GitHub Package Registry
// ~/docker/config.json
{
"credsStore": "desktop",
"credHelpers": {
"docker.pkg.github.com": "gh",
"ghcr.io": "gh"
}
}

ESPHome PWM fan using a Wemos D1 mini lite
# Controlling my Buva Qstream ventilation system using:
# * A Wemos D1 mini lite (an ESP8266 based board)
# * A Wemos power shield so I can power the Wemos from the ventilation units 12V supply.
# * A simple PWM to 10V convertor like this: https://www.cheaptech.nl/pwm-signaal-te-voltage-converter-1-3-khz-0-10-v-pw.html
# * The amazing ESPHome firmware tool: https://esphome.io
# * Home Assistant to tie it all together: https://www.home-assistant.io
#
# I used to use a Raspberry Pi and some Python code for this. See https://gist.github.com/SqyD/a927ab612df767a0cc892bcde23d025c
# The Wemos approach seems more stable and doesn't require external USB power.

Rook v0.8.0 device/osd removal
# This will use osd.5 as an example
# ceph commands are expected to be run in the rook-toolbox
1) disk fails
2) remove disk from node
3) mark out osd. `ceph osd out osd.5`
4) remove from crush map. `ceph osd crush remove osd.5`
5) delete caps. `ceph auth del osd.5`
6) remove osd. `ceph osd rm osd.5`
7) delete the deployment `kubectl delete deployment -n rook-ceph rook-ceph-osd-id-5`
8) delete osd data dir on node `rm -rf /var/lib/rook/osd5`
